Ilhéus is a charming coastal city in Bahia, Brazil, known for its rich history and stunning beaches. Visitors are drawn to its vibrant culture, colonial architecture, and the warm hospitality of its residents.
The city offers a laid-back atmosphere, perfect for those looking to unwind. While the beaches are a major draw, the local cuisine and historical sites provide a deeper insight into the region's heritage.

历史
Ilhéus was founded in 1534 and quickly became a significant port for the cocoa trade. Its lush surroundings and favorable climate made it an ideal location for cocoa plantations, leading to economic prosperity in the 19th century.
The city has a rich cultural heritage, influenced by indigenous, African, and Portuguese traditions. Today, Ilhéus is known not only for its historical significance but also for its contributions to Brazilian literature, particularly through the works of Jorge Amado.
